Evotique Posted February 26, 2013 Share Posted February 26, 2013 Bonjour, Depuis quelque temps je m'intéresse à la technologie NFC qui permet de lire ou d'écrire des tags sur des puces. Je m'intéresse plus à la sécurité et je souhaite relever un défi : lire et écrire sur des badges pour machine à café. Sur de nombreuses machines à café, on peut utiliser un petit badge pour payer ses boissons. Ce badge utilise la technologie NFC (type A) mais je n'arrive pas à le lire. J'ai utilisé une application, TagInfo qui permet de "sniffer" les puces et de retourner des caractéristiques. Voilà ce que j'obtiens : ** TagInfo scan (version 1.40) 2013-02-26 14:48:26 ** # IC manufacturer: Infineon Technologies AG -------------------------------------- # NFC data set storage not present: -------------------------------------- -------------------------------------- # Technologies supported: ISO/IEC 14443-3 (Type A) compatible ISO/IEC 14443-2 (Type A) compatible # Android technology information: android.nfc.tech.NfcA * Maximum transceive length: 253 bytes * Default maximum transceive time-out: 618 ms Tag description: * TAG: Tech [android.nfc.tech.NfcA] # Detailed protocol information: ID: A5:28:F3:D0 ATQA: 0x0400 SAK: 0x00 -------------------------------------- Et là, je ne comprends pas : pourquoi la machine peut lire cette puce et pas moi ? De plus, je n'ai pas trouvé à quoi correspond ATQA et SAK. Pouvez-vous m'aider à "déchiffrer" ce rapport ? Si possible, trouver une solution pour pouvoir lire / écrire sur cette puce ? Par avance, merci ! Quote Link to comment Share on other sites More sharing options...
Ecrou Posted February 8, 2015 Share Posted February 8, 2015 Tout est décrit dans la norme ISO/IEC 14443-3. La reception de l'ATQA (answer to request type A) indique qu'il faut appliquer le protocole d'activation de la carte. Les bits du SAK (select acknoledge) permettent d'identifier le type de puce. ça permet d'identifier le type de puce, après il faut appliquer le protocole qui lui est propre (selection d'application dans la puce, authentifications, etc) Quote Link to comment Share on other sites More sharing options...
Recommended Posts
Join the conversation
You can post now and register later. If you have an account, sign in now to post with your account.